A clean pipe is a type of DDoS mitigation solution that protects against volumetric DDoS attacks. The clean pipe service blocks network flood attack traffic before it enters an organization's network and ensures that the organisation's services are available to their legitimate users.
A clean pipe is a partial DDoS mitigation solution for online businesses and mission critical websites that require real-time protection against volumetric DDoS attacks.
